mhxvmjsr03.evyiha.cn Server iP:
Current resolution:
domain resolution record:
2026-04-13-----2026-04-13 113.105.142.61
2026-04-13-----2026-04-13 113.105.142.139
2026-04-13-----2026-04-13 43.141.111.12
2026-04-13-----2026-04-13 122.188.57.50
2026-04-13-----2026-04-13 119.86.194.231
2026-04-13-----2026-04-13 116.153.76.58
2026-04-13-----2026-04-13 119.86.220.13
2026-04-13-----2026-04-13 220.194.72.86
2026-04-13-----2026-04-13 116.196.151.133
2026-04-13-----2026-04-13 115.231.71.96
2026-04-13-----2026-04-13 119.86.220.16
2026-04-13-----2026-04-13 120.226.80.137
2026-04-13-----2026-04-13 120.226.80.191
2026-04-13-----2026-04-13 119.86.220.11
2026-04-13-----2026-04-13 218.61.120.189
2026-04-13-----2026-04-13 157.119.253.104
2026-04-13-----2026-04-13 183.60.159.247
2026-04-13-----2026-04-13 115.231.71.107
2026-04-13-----2026-04-13 171.105.216.110
2026-04-13-----2026-04-13 218.61.120.184
2026-04-13-----2026-04-13 183.214.154.103
2026-04-13-----2026-04-13 36.136.121.76
2026-04-13-----2026-04-13 120.226.80.190
2026-04-13-----2026-04-13 220.194.72.89
2026-04-13-----2026-04-13 183.60.159.177
2026-04-13-----2026-04-13 120.226.80.54
2026-04-13-----2026-04-13 43.141.99.166
2026-04-13-----2026-04-13 157.119.253.103
2026-04-13-----2026-04-13 118.183.242.149
2026-04-13-----2026-04-13 120.226.80.135
2026-04-13-----2026-04-13 183.204.94.135
2026-04-13-----2026-04-13 60.165.67.152
2026-04-13-----2026-04-13 119.86.195.16
2026-04-13-----2026-04-13 36.136.121.79
2026-04-13-----2026-04-13 60.31.192.56
2026-04-13-----2026-04-13 61.162.8.70
- website server lookup history
- jumavaoc.com
- xxxxxxxxx3.com
- www.5c5c5ccom.com
- 101835.com
- zthy98.com
- 0149888.com
- www.90b62k.com
- xfyouth.com
- www.yw38777.com
- 2330.com
- kmao5.com
- www554400.com
- zenantouzi.com
- www.m5b2.com
- wusong88.com
- beimiao.com
- www.xjxjxj.com
- pixsy.com
- ebiz.dillards.com
- www.dogxxx.com
- hosting ip address lookup history
- 121.37.207.89
- 104.31.29.248
- 39.96.95.218
- 118.99.214.234
- 103.135.249.11
- 118.107.170.164
- 39.105.228.31
- 108.186.94.57
- 103.75.15.156
- 156.234.127.158
- 94.191.87.135
- 67.205.58.160
- 38.45.127.116
- 154.23.56.2
- 104.16.203.56
- 104.247.81.99
- 113.44.151.61
- 104.164.1.87
- 54.231.80.234
- 154.208.64.97
